Original Description
Jan Daemen Cool's A Portrait Of A Gentleman And His Wife is a captivating example of 17th-century Dutch portraiture, radiating quiet dignity and refined elegance. Painted during the Dutch Golden Age, this double portrait embodies the period's fascination with realism, domestic harmony, and social status. The couple is depicted with restrained yet expressive poses, their richly textured garments—likely of fine silk and lace—speaking volumes about their prosperity. Cool’s meticulous brushwork highlights delicate facial expressions and intricate details, from the gentleman’s lace collar to his wife’s pearl jewelry, while the subdued earthy tones and soft lighting create an atmosphere of solemn intimacy. Though lesser-known than contemporaries like Rembrandt or Frans Hals, Cool’s work exemplifies the Northern Renaissance’s precision combined with Baroque emotional depth, making it a valuable piece for understanding middle-class patronage and marital symbolism in Dutch art.
